The Indiana Area School Board will meet tonight, with a number of personnel items on the agenda, as well as consideration of motions for summer programs.
The board will consider a motion to authorize the Buildings, Grounds, & Transportation Committee to interview two architectural firms for design services for potential future projects. The directive would include but not be limited to modifying the office configurations at the Eisenhower and East Pike elementary schools, installing an elevator at the Horace Mann Elementary School, designing an accessible path to the middle wing at Ben Franklin Elementary School, and a proposal for a meaningful district-wide feasibility study option.
The committee would then be tasked with bringing to the board a proposed contract from the recommended firm.
